Abstract

Official abstract text for this publication.

A display apparatus includes a substrate including a display area and a peripheral area at least partially surrounding the display area. A corner of an edge of the display area is curved. The peripheral area includes a pad area. A data line is disposed in the display area. A first connecting line is disposed in the display area and is connected to the data line to transmit a signal from the pad area to the data line. The first connecting line includes a first portion extending tram the edge in a direction away from the peripheral area and a second portion bent with respect to the first portion and extending towards the corner.

What is claimed is: 1. A display apparatus comprising: a substrate comprising a display area and a peripheral area at least partially surrounding the display area, wherein the peripheral area comprises a pad area; a data line disposed in the display area; and a first connecting line disposed in the display area and connected to the data line, the first connecting line transmitting a signal from a pad of the pad area to the data line, wherein the display area comprises a dummy area adjacent to a boundary between the display area and the peripheral area, wherein the first connecting line comprises a first portion disposed within the display area, extending from an edge of the display area adjacent to the pad area in a direction away from the peripheral area, and a second portion disposed within the display area and bent with respect to the first portion and extending towards a corner of the edge of the display area, wherein the second portion is connected to the data line in the dummy area. 2. The display apparatus of claim 1 , wherein, in the first connecting line, the first portion and the second portion extend in a direction inclined with respect to a first direction in which the data line extends. 3. The display apparatus of claim 2 , wherein the first portion and the second portion of the first connecting line extend in a zigzag shape. 4. The display apparatus of claim 2 , wherein the first portion and the second portion of the first connecting line extend linearly. 5. The display apparatus of claim 1 , wherein the data line and the first connecting line are on different layers from each other. 6. A display apparatus comprising: a substrate comprising a display area and a peripheral area at least partially surrounding the display area, wherein the peripheral area comprises a pad area; a data line disposed in the display area; and a first connecting line disposed in the display area and connected to the data line, the first connecting line transmitting a signal from the pad area to the data line, wherein the display area comprises a dummy area adjacent to a boundary between the display area and the peripheral area, wherein the first connecting line comprises a first portion, extending from an edge of the display area in a direction away from the peripheral area, and a second portion bent with respect to the first portion and extending towards a corner of the edge of the display area, wherein the second portion is connected to the data line in the dummy area, and wherein the first connecting, line further comprises a third portion extending in a first direction in which the data line extends and/or a fourth portion extending in a second direction perpendicular to the first direction. 7. The display apparatus of claim 1 , further comprising a second connecting line disposed in the peripheral area and comprising a first end connected to the first portion of the first connecting line and a second end disposed in the pad area. 8. A display apparatus comprising: a substrate comprising a display area and a peripheral area at least partially surrounding the display area, wherein the peripheral area comprises a pad area; a plurality of scan lines disposed in the display area and each scan line of the plurality of scan lines extending in a first direction; a plurality of first data lines disposed in the display area and each first data line of the plurality of first data lines extending in a second direction perpendicular to the first direction; and a plurality of first connecting lines disposed in the display area and connected to the plurality of first data lines to transmit a signal from pads of the pad area to the plurality of first data lines, wherein each of the plurality of first connecting lines comprises a first portion disposed in the display area, extending from an edge of the display area adjacent to the pad area in a direction away from the peripheral area, and a second portion disposed in the display area and bent from the first portion and extending towards a corner of the edge of the display area, wherein each of the first portion and the second portion alternates between a first sub-portion extending parallel to at least one of the plurality of scan lines and a second sub-portion extending parallel to at least one of the plurality of first data lines. 9. The display apparatus of claim 8 , wherein, in each of the plurality of first connecting lines, the first portion and the second portion extend in a direction inclined with respect to the first direction while alternating between the first sub-portion and the second sub-portion. 10. The display apparatus of claim 8 , wherein the plurality of first connecting lines are on a different layer from the plurality of scan lines. 11. The display apparatus of claim 10 , wherein the first sub-portion at least partially overlaps the at least one scan line. 12. The display apparatus of claim 8 , wherein the plurality of first connecting lines are on a different layer from the plurality of first data lines. 13. The display apparatus of claim 12 , wherein the second sub-portion at least partially overlaps the at least one first data line. 14. The display apparatus of claim 8 , wherein the first sub-portion has a length that is n times (where n is a positive integer) as much as a first length corresponding to a distance between two adjacent first data lines, and the second sub-portion has a length that is m times (where in is a positive integer) as much as a second length corresponding to a distance between two adjacent scan lines. 15. The display apparatus of claim 8 , wherein the first sub-portions of adjacent first connecting lines are spaced apart from each other by a length that is n times (where n is a positive integer) as much as a second length corresponding to a distance between two adjacent scan lines, and the second sub-portions of the adjacent first connecting lines are spaced apart from each other by a length that is m times (where m is a positive integer) as much as a first length corresponding to a distance between two adjacent first data lines. 16. The display apparatus of claim 8 , wherein each of the plurality of first connecting lines further comprises a third portion connected to the first portion and extending linearly in the first direction and a fourth portion connected to the second portion and extending linearly in the first direction. 17. The display apparatus of claim 16 , wherein each of the plurality of first connecting lines further comprises a fifth portion disposed between the first portion and the second portion and extending linearly in the first direction. 18. The display apparatus of claim 8 , wherein the display area comprises a dummy area adjacent to a boundary between the display area and the peripheral area, wherein the second portion is connected to one of the plurality of first data lines in the dummy area disposed at the corner of the edge of the display area. 19. The display apparatus of claim 8 , further comprising a second connecting line disposed in the peripheral area and comprising a first end connected to the first portion of each of the plurality of first connecting lines and a second end disposed in the pad area. 20.
